Duties and Responsibilities
  • Conduct initial dental assessments and diagnose patients' oral health condition.
  • Perform dental prophylaxis, fluoride treatments, and sealant applications.
  • Take dental X‑rays as required and interpret them for treatment planning.
  • Educate patients on maintaining proper oral hygiene and preventive dental care.
  • Document patient care and maintain accurate patient records adhering to the clinic and industry standards.
  • Collaborate with dentists to plan treatments and care for periodontal diseases.
  • Manage time effectively to schedule and treat patients in a timely manner.
  • Ensure the sterility and proper maintenance of equipment and tools used in treatments.
  • Update patient history and document dental treatment for future reference and legal requirements.
  • Administer local anesthesia for dental procedures as needed.
  • Engage in ongoing education and training to stay updated with the latest in dental hygiene and dentistry.
Requirements
  • Must hold a valid dental hygiene license in the state of Arizona.
  • Certification in local anesthesia permitted in the state of Arizona.
  • Minimum of 2 years' experience in a dental practice preferred.
  • Proficiency in using dental record software and managing patient records digitally.
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ills to communicate effectively with patients and staff.
  • Keen attention to detail and the ability to work meticulously with tools and small objects.
  • A commitment to ethical practices and maintaining patient confidentiality.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and remain organized in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Strong educational foundation in dental hygiene practices, patient care, and treatment planning.
  • A passion for dental health and the well‑being of patients.
